Also, base game costs like 6 euros at key resellers (more if you want steam key but I don't recommend getting steam keys for mmos, there's always some problems) and has shitload of content - enough to last you until a sale of the ultimate pack if you really like the game. The issues from the ultimate pack are aimed at late/end-game players anyway.

So thanks to Hoaxmetal I played the game a bit. I liked the little introduction videos for the each factions, but out of all of them I liked the Templars the most. They seemed to be the most reasonable of the lot. The Illuminati were just dicks and the Dragons were.. ¯\_(ツ)_/¯

I initially began to make my character look like Steven Seagal but then I realized that I could make my guy look like this:
hqdefault.jpg

So naturally I stuck with it.

I like the atmosphere in the game and the gameplay is aight. Environ design is quite cool and I like it when they get crazy and creative and there's ton of flavor text littered around the world. My only complaint is that it's an "MMO". To me that seems to be its biggest weakness. They should've just gone with a singleplayer game, maybe. Hard to tell how it comes around later, but that's how it feels like after playing it a bit in the beginning. I think it's a gud enough game but it's not the MMO I'm looking for now. I just recently quit FF14 and I got my fill of story heavy MMOs from that game. I want something more group oriented, so I'm sticking with EQ for now. I'm still gonna play the game for the 3 day trial and I'm buying the ultimate edition when it's on sale again.

Templar has the exclusive access to one of best missions in the game and Richard Sonnac is indeed the most reasonable handler you can have... but Dragon seems to be the "chosen" faction at the moment with the longest history and subtlest story. Don't know much about Illuminati though.

IIRC last 3 dungeons don't have a normal version, they start as elite.

What eyes in Ankh? The motes?

The Facility has rather explicit lore regarding Dreamers and Filth. Both Facility and Slaughterhouse are IMO the most atmospheric and badass dungeons - old soviet bunkers filled with Filth and monstrous biomechanical creations. I also kinda have a crush on Halina.

Wat?

- the ones on first boss move in regular pattern - you need to fit in

- the ones on first Dr. Klein go on either left or right and you need to hug the other side of the bridge

- the ones on second Dr. Klein are also avoidable (by tank, dps doesn't even come close)

If you need a detailed guide - google "loms ankh".
